Special Issue Introduction

Cities around the world are prone to several natural and human-made hazards, and effective risk analysis and reduction are only possible if all relevant threats are considered and analyzed. Nevertheless, the examination of multi-hazards poses a range of additional challenges due to the differing characteristics of processes. This Special Issue will focus on the issue for all aspects of multi-hazards and the construction of a policy support system that can help mitigate the effects of disasters for resilient mega-cities.

Aimed topics can be, but are not confined to:
Earthquake hazard and risk analysis
Wind field simulation for large-scale problems
Vulnerability assessment of typhoon in urban area
Rapid evaluation of urban fire risk
Life-cycle risk analysis of infrastructure systems
Community resilience under multi-hazards
Public safety management policy
